Thomas Bowden, an orthopedic technician at Sturgeon Community Hospital in Alberta, is using 3D printing to create detailed anatomical models for better patient care.
These models, which include precise bone replicas, help doctors plan surgeries and educate patients, reducing complications and anxiety.
Bowden, a retired soldier, aims to create customized, more comfortable splints and casts using this technology.
